Graph hyperbola: y squared / 169 - x squared / 16 = 1
y^2/169-x^2/16=1
This is a hyperbola with vertical transverse axis with center at (0,0):
see graph below:
y=±(169+169x^2/16)^.5

slopes of asymptotes: a/b=13/4
equation of asymptotes:
y=13x/4
and
-13x/4
